The National Hurricane Center (NHC) is a division of the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) responsible for monitoring, forecasting, and providing information about tropical cyclones in the Atlantic and eastern North Pacific. The NHC plays a crucial role in issuing timely alerts and forecasts that help minimize the impacts of hurricanes and tropical storms on communities and infrastructure.
